Espaços comunicativos do imaginário: fofocas e boatos no cenário organizacional
Author
Assis Iasbeck, Luiz Carlos
Abstract
The organizations -public or private, opened or closed- are strongly characterized for the communicative flows that privilege and exclude.The official speech (assigned as ¿well-said¿) is the space of reaffirmations of the ideological and the strategical intentions of the organizations. However, ¿not-said¿, communicative structure that we know as gossips and rumors, they constitute a phenomenon to the part of the scientific studies of the organizational communication.In this work, we explore the images that populate the imaginary organizational and they gain materiality in structures subversive narratives, disabled to appear in the organizational scene.
